Choll Aces 10, PIC 9

Choll Aces was trailing in the first to sixth inning when they crept back and snatched the victory from PIC, 10-9.

The score was 9-6, on PIC’s advantage at the bottom of the sixth inning, and when the top of the seventh came, Darwin Masaharu and Manny Sablan rallied to push Choll Aces from behind scoring four straight runs.

Masaharu hit a two-run triple sending Sablan and Brandon Hocog to the homeplate.

Sablan homered, went 3-for-4 and hit two RBIs sending himself and Dennis Renguul score runs.

PIC’s Tommy Kerington in a losing effort also hit a home run and went 4-for-4. He hit an RBI and scored two runs.

Kevin Carey hit three RBIs and went 3-for-3.

Ready Mix 15,  Sai-pal 5

Jack Saralu was 1-for2 and hit two RBIs allowing Audy Maratita and Dave Lizama to score runs.

RJ Attao went 2-for-2, scored two runs and also sent Lizama home for an RBI.

Henry Palacios went 3-for-4 and hit an RBI to score Rey Cepeda.

Palacios struck out two as he pitched seven straight innings.

Sai-pal’s Gloyd Martin homered and went 3-for-4. He also hit two RBIs to score himself and Poland Masaharu in the fourth inning.
